OK, hands up, I goofed. So how do I make sure I only block the user name, and not the IP as well? Spica the Hiver If you tolerate this, then your children will be next... 04:35, 22 May 2008 (EDT)

On the block page there's 3 check boxes (I think) - one says something like "Automatically block this address ...... - just make sure that's UNchecked. SusanG  ContribsTalk 04:45, 22 May 2008 (EDT)
(edit conflict) When you arrive at the "block this user" screen, there is check box labeled Automatically block the last IP address used by this user, and any subsequent IPs they try to edit from. Uncheck that option. Star of David.png Radioactive afikomen Please ignore all my awful pre-2014 comments. 04:46, 22 May 2008 (EDT)
Two minds with but a .... SusanG  ContribsTalk 04:49, 22 May 2008 (EDT)
Thanks guys. Sorry, Spica, I should described how when I left my little note. ħψAnarchy dd00dd.pngUser talk:Human 13:09, 22 May 2008 (EDT)
By the way, the only time it's really an issue is if someone wants to undo a "longer" block - they also have to pay attention and undo the IP block as well if it's there. In the case of a repetitive genuine vandal who appears to be simply making new usernames, blocking their IP might help - although if they are using proxies, it is of no avail anyway. ħψAnarchy dd00dd.pngUser talk:Human 13:18, 22 May 2008 (EDT)

How about an old copy of Paint Shop Pro? I use version six, and I've seen slightly later versions (7,8,9...) for sale on the web in the $15-30 price range. It's a good, versatile program, no Photoshop, but who needs most of what PS can do anyway? PSP can handle layers in its native format (.psp), and the built-in animation shop allows creation and editing of animated .gifs. ħumanUser talk:Human 18:49, 5 June 2008 (EDT)
